WebJul 6, 2024 · It is recommended to cycle a new shrimp tank for a minimum of a month before adding shrimp. Most shrimpkeepers even recommend two months to be safe. This is to ensure that not only is the tank cycled, but also mature – you want your tank to grow an adequate amount of biofilm before you add your shrimp. WebAdd the shrimp. When you're ready to add the shrimp to the tank, you should use the drip acclimate method to give them a smooth transition into their new home. Web4) Place a rubber band around the tubing and tighten it to the point where only a drip per 1 second (1 Mississippi) is released. 5) Allow the aquarium water to slowly drip into your shrimp bucket for about 30 minutes. 6) If all looks well, you can now use a net to scoop your shrimp into your new shrimp tank.
